VanEck Short Muni ETF (SMB) and Invesco California AMT-Free Municipal Bond ETF (PWZ) belong to the same industry segment: Municipal Bonds. Both ETFs have the same top 1 sector exposures: Municipal. SMB is less expensive with a Total Expense Ratio (TER) of 0.07%, versus 0.28% for PWZ. SMB is up 0.74% year-to-date (YTD) with +$24M in YTD flows. Frequently asked questions about SMB and PWZ

How have the SMB and PWZ ETFs performed in 2026?

As of September 2, 2026, SMB is up 0.74% year-to-date (YTD), while PWZ has lost -2.78%. That puts SMB better performer ahead so far this year.

Which ETF is attracting more investor money: SMB or PWZ?

Year-to-date, the SMB ETF saw +$24M in flows, compared to +$155M for PWZ.

Which ETF is more volatile: SMB or PWZ?

Over the past year, SMB had a volatility of 0.99%, while PWZ experienced 3.67%.

Which ETF is bigger: SMB or PWZ?

As of September 2, 2026, SMB holds $316.70 M in assets under management (AUM), while PWZ manages $1.21 B.

What sectors do the SMB and PWZ ETFs invest in?

SMB leans toward sectors like Municipal. Meanwhile, PWZ focuses on Municipal.
